Gyeonggi Province to Hold "Beauty and Health Material Technology Commercialization Briefing" on July 15, Introducing Promising Technologies
Gyeonggi Province and the Gyeonggi Institute of Economic Science and Technology will hold the "2025 Beauty and Health Material Technology Commercialization Briefing Session" on July 15 at Gwanggyo Hall on the first floor of the Gyeonggi Institute within Suwon Gwanggyo Technovalley, under the theme of "Sustainable Development of Gyeonggi's Beauty and Health Industry with Technological Innovation."
This briefing session will introduce eight promising technologies discovered through the "Development of Domestic and International Natural and Synthetic Material Sources" project. The event aims to strengthen the competitiveness of companies in response to changes in the beauty and healthcare industry, and to promote the commercialization of public technologies.
The technologies to be presented and exhibited include: ▲ compositions for the prevention, improvement, and treatment of Alzheimer's disease ▲ compositions for gastric mucosal protection and the prevention or treatment of gastric ulcers ▲ pharmaceutical compositions for the prevention or treatment of muscle atrophy ▲ materials for the prevention and improvement of asthma ▲ new drug lead compounds for the prevention and treatment of obesity, among others.
Additionally, the Gyeonggi Institute will introduce "104 shared patented technologies developed by the institute" at the event and conduct one-on-one technology consultations between researchers and technology seekers.

Um Kiman, Director of the Bio Industry Division of Gyeonggi Province, said, "We expect this technology briefing session to serve as a practical platform for cooperation between technology-holding institutions and companies in need, and to become a turning point that drives qualitative growth in the beauty and healthcare industry ecosystem of Gyeonggi Province."
